Let's start at the beginning of the experience. We arrived at 6:20 and stood in line until we were able to order at 6:43. We each ordered the Duo combo. None of the tables had been wiped down, we found the least messy one we could and sat down for a 30 minute wait. To be fair the cashier had warned us that our order would take 15-20 minutes. The first of three meals arrived, the other two were a few minutes later. The onion rings I paid extra for were cold and the sliders were right behind temperature wise. The trays they were served on were ice cold, so that didn't help. I ordered the Merguez and lamb patties. I could not tell the difference between them, so I'm not sure I got what I ordered. The sliders were good, though not as good as others like 5 Guys or Smash or... My son ordered a regular beef patty and a chicken breast patty. The chicken was huge and spiced with pepper. He enjoyed the sandwich a lot. Overall the food as just OK. I will not be going back anytime soon though. The wait is far too long and the food is not worth the 10/plate with that kind of wait This is not the place for a quick bite. Though I did not purchase a beer you should expect to pay 6 on average for a glass.

I ordered the Duo burgers, which are basically two sliders sized burgers. They were delicious. The staff were friendly and the wait time was minimal for a Monday. They have free kid Mondays, so your kids can order a kids' meal (5.99) -3 oz burger or chicken strips, fries, and drink. They also have vegetarian and gluten free options.
